A piece of metal is cooled in a water calorimeter. This process increases the water temperature by 7.0°C. How much energy is lost if there is 100. g of water in the calorimeter? (specific heat of water is 4.184 J/g°C)

Heat changes

Q = m.c.Δt

Q = 100 g x 4.184 J/g°C x 7 °C

Q = 2928.8 J
